Thomas Wouters wrote: > I would personally prefer the AST validation to be a separate part of the > compiler. It means the one or the other can be out of sync, but it also > means it can be accessed directly (validating AST before sending it to the > compiler) and the compiler (or CFG generator, or something between AST and > CFG) can decide not to validate internally generated AST for non-debug > builds, for instance. That's how the ast-objects branch currently works. There is a method checking that the tree actually conforms to the grammar. Regards, Martin
